What a bloody palaver!!! I got an email from the seller, steve. But it want steve, it was Kath his wife, who had listed a load of his belongings in a "fit of rage"

She was sorry, and said I could not buy the statue, and could sort it out with her husband when he got back from his holiday.

If you click on the link, i put up, you will see that "she" is still selling her "husbands" stuff on ebay, and the auctions are going very well. Check the descriptions of the equipment, they are very concise, and detailed, and informative. For somebody selling someone elses stuff, she knows her stuff.

Well, I was not taking this crapola without a fight, I never do. The Macleod family motto on my coat of arms is "Hold fast"

I went into overdrive, and went all Darkside on their asses!!

The bottom line??

The guy never used a reserve, and his item ended on a fraction of what he wanted. Rules is rules, and I TOLD them I would be travelling north tonight to get it. They started acting all weird, saying I was not to collect it from their house, and that I should meet him in a B&Q carpark in Bamber bridge. So I agreed, and packed my trusty sledgehammer handle into the Hearse, as well as taking a very handy pal of mine. I call it insurance, I was entering into the unknown, and meeting a person whos emails were sketchy, shifty, and most unfriendly. If I was going to get a beating over a Vader statue, then I would give a good account for myself.


Well, I was met by a middle aged gentleman in a shirt and tie, and a shy teenage girl, who stayed in the car. I was met with no trouble, and finally got my Vader statue. The moral of this story is this-

If some goon on ebay pulls this on you, stand up to them, and remind them that they have entered into a legally binding contract, and that you have the law on your side.

It worked for me.
